In this work, we investigated the efficacy of three new biocides (77351, 73532, 73503--NALCO®) as specific antifouling products against adult organisms of the bivalve Brachidontes pharaonis (Fischer P., 1870), a Lessepsian species introduced in the Mediterranean Sea by sea transport (ballast water), and which has recently shown invasive behaviour in an industrial plant in Southern Italy (Sicily). These biocides were tested to verify their efficacy, as well as their environmental compatibility at discharge point, using the crustacean belonging to the genus Artemia (Leach, 1819) as model organism, according to Government Decree (D. Lgs) No. 152/06. Biocides were also tested using alternative crustaceans, Amphibalanus amphitrite (Darwin, 1854), and Tigriopus fulvus (Fischer, 1860), in order to check whether their introduction as model species in the national regulation could affect discharge limit concentrations (DLC) due to their different sensitivity, with likely economic and technical repercussions in the industrial water treatment sector.

Because cobalamin deficiency is routinely treated with parenteral cobalamin, we investigated the efficacy of oral therapy. We randomly assigned 38 newly diagnosed cobalamin deficient patients to receive cyanocobalamin as either 1 mg intramuscularly on days 1, 3, 7, 10, 14, 21, 30, 60, and 90 or 2 mg orally on a daily basis for 120 days. Therapeutic effectiveness was evaluated by measuring hematologic and neurologic improvement and changes in serum levels of cobalamin (normal, 200 to 900 pg/mL) methylmalonic acid (normal, 73 to 271 nmol/L), and homocysteine (normal, 5.1 to 13.9 micromol/L). Five patients were subsequently found to have folate deficiency, which left 18 evaluable patients in the oral group and 15 in the parenteral group. Correction of hematologic and neurologic abnormalities was prompt and indistinguishable between the 2 groups. The mean pretreatment values for serum cobalamin, methylmalonic acid, and homocysteine were, respectively, 93 pg/mL, 3,850 nmol/L, and 37. 2 micromol/L in the oral group and 95 pg/mL, 3,630 nmol/L, and 40.0 micromol/L in the parenteral therapy group. After 4 months of therapy, the respective mean values were 1,005 pg/mL, 169 nmol/L, and 10.6 micromol/L in the oral group and 325 pg/mL, 265 nmol/L, and 12.2 micromol/L in the parenteral group. The higher serum cobalamin and lower serum methylmalonic acid levels at 4 months posttreatment in the oral group versus the parenteral group were significant, with P < .0005 and P < .05, respectively. In cobalamin deficiency, 2 mg of cyanocobalamin administered orally on a daily basis was as effective as 1 mg administered intramuscularly on a monthly basis and may be superior.

While Epstein-Barr viral (EBV) DNA is nearly always detectable in African Burkitt's lymphoma (BL), the relatively low frequency of BL in EBV-positive African children and the infrequent finding of EBV in American BL suggest that other cofactors may contribute to the malignant transformation. Among these possible cofactors are type C oncornaviruses. To evaluate this possibility, we screened the cellular DNA from 16 lymphomas (2 African, 14 American) and the DNA from 20 lymphoma-derived cell lines (4 African, 16 American) with a radiolabeled viral DNA probe from EBV and two oncornaviral probes (murine amphotropic 1504A virus and simian sarcoma virus). The radiolabeled EBV DNA probe hybridized with 18 of 36 tumor or cell line DNA's. Only 2 of 11 American BL tumors contained detectable EBV sequences. However, the cell lines derived from three EBV-negative tumors converted in vitro to EBV positivity, suggesting that some of the tumor cells could be infected with EBV. In contrast, none of the tumors or the cell lines derived therefrom hybridized with either the 1504A or the simian sarcoma virus probes, decreasing the likelihood that type C viruses are cofactors with EBV.
